Fan Power Connectors: CPUFAN1/SFAN1/Power Fan
The CPUFAN1 (processor fan), SFAN1 (system fan), and Power Fan support
system cooling fan with +12V. It supports three-pin head connector. When
connecting the wire to the connectors, always take note that the red wire is the
positive and should be connected to the +12V, the black wire is Ground and
should be connected to GND. If the mainboard has a System Hardware Moni-
tor chipset on-board, you must use a specially designed fan with speed sensor
to take advantage of the CPU fan control.

Note:
1. Always consult the vendor for proper CPU cooling fan.
2. CPU Fan supports the fan control. You can install the PC Alert
utility that will automatically control the CPU Fan speed accord-
ing to the actual CPU temperature.
